Define variation and give its importance?

\tVariation can be defined as the difference between the cells, organisms or group of organisms belonging to a particular species by environmental factors (phenotypic variation) or genetic differences (genotypic variations).\tIt is caused by gene mutations due to certain environmental factors and various combinations of genetic material.\xa0\tVariation is important because it causes evolution and is the basis of heredity.\tIt is advantageous to a population as it enables few individuals to adapt to the environment changes thus, enabling the survival of the population.
